To write:
The term that does not belong in the group.
Introduction:
Sponges have walls which are linked with many small pores referred to as ostia that permit water circulate the sponge. They filter water to attain their food so they're recognised as filter feeders. Gemmules are internal buds observed in sponges and are involved in asexual reproduction. A nematocyst is a capsule that holds a coiled, threadlike tube containing poison and barbs, which is found in cnidarians.
Explanation of Solution
A sponge is covered with tiny pores, known as ostia, which lead internally to a system of canals and eventually out to one or more larger holes, known as oscula. In order get food; sponges filter water by their bodies in a process called as filter-feeding. Water is drawn into the sponge through tiny holes known as incurrent pores. Gemmules are internal buds observed in sponges and are involved in asexual reproduction. Nemotocysts are found in cnidarians.A nematocyst is a capsulethat holds a coiled, threadlike tube containing poison and barbs.
A sponge contains tiny pores, filter feeding and also gemmules which are involve in reproduction. Nematocysts do not belong in the group because these are found in Cnidarians.
